Updating Label Flicker

Hello, new around here, and I've a small problem that I hope can be solved.

I have a "Score" label setup to update with a numerical value each time a hotspot is clicked on, it works great. However, every time the score label is updated with a new value, the whole label seems to flicker, or blink if you will. I'm using the newest version of AC, and using AC menu for displaying the label as well.

    This'll likely be down to a combination of your ActionList used to update the value, and the Menu's Appear type setting.  If it's set to During Gameplay, then it will be disabled whenever a gameplay-blocking ActionList is run - no matter how briefly it lasts.

    In that case, the answer would be to either change the Appear type to Manual, and use the Menu: Change state Action to turn in on and off when required, or to simply set the ActionList's When running property to Run In Background, to prevent gameplay from being blocked.

    Perfect. What worked from your advice was setting ActionList's When running to Run In Background. I had to make a couple tweaks as well. I changed the Appear type to Hotspot, as this is the functionality I needed for my game.
